In the realm of modern storytelling, few mediums offer the sheer versatility and creative liberty found in Japanese animation (anime) and comics (manga). For the uninitiated, the vast library of available titles can feel overwhelming, ranging from high-octane action spectacles to introspective slice-of-life dramas. However, certain series have risen to the top not only for their popularity but for their ability to showcase the breadth of the medium. Whether a viewer seeks breathtaking battles, intricate mysteries, or heartfelt emotion, the following recommendations serve as perfect entry points into the world of anime and manga.

For those drawn to the shonen genre—stories originally targeted at young teen boys that emphasize action and personal growth—two titles stand as modern pillars: Attack on Titan and Jujutsu Kaisen. Attack on Titan (Shingeki no Kyojin) redefined the action landscape with its grim tone and complex political intrigue. Set in a world where humanity lives behind massive walls to protect themselves from man-eating giants, the series deconstructs themes of freedom and morality, offering a narrative that is as intellectually stimulating as it is visceral. On the other hand, Jujutsu Kaisen offers a more traditional but expertly executed battle system, blending dark fantasy with high school drama. Its dynamic animation and fluid combat choreography make it a thrill to watch, while the manga showcases intricate art that captures the intensity of sorcery battles.

While shonen dominates the mainstream, the medium offers profound depth in other demographics. For viewers who prefer intellectual puzzles over physical brawls, Death Note remains the gold standard of psychological thrillers. The cat-and-mouse game between a genius high school student and a detective, centered around a notebook that can kill anyone whose name is written in it, creates a tension that is universally gripping. Conversely, for those seeking emotional resonance rather than suspense, Frieren: Beyond Journey’s End offers a melancholic yet beautiful fantasy. Unlike typical adventure stories, Frieren focuses on the aftermath of the hero’s journey, exploring themes of grief, memory, and the passage of time through the eyes of an immortal elf. It is a masterpiece in "healing" anime, proving that quiet moments can be just as impactful as explosive ones.

A unique recommendation that bridges the gap between realism and historical fantasy is Vinland Saga. While its first season delivers Viking warfare that satisfies any craving for action, the series evolves into a profound exploration of pacifism and redemption. It is a story that grows with its audience, transitioning from a tale of revenge to a meditation on what it means to be a true warrior. The manga, in particular, is renowned for its detailed artwork and expressive character writing, making it a must-read for those who appreciate character-driven narratives.

Finally, no recommendation list is complete without mentioning the timeless appeal of One Piece. As the best-selling manga in history, it is often viewed as a daunting commitment due to its length. However, its endurance is a testament to its masterful world-building and emotional payoff. Author Eiichiro Oda has created a world where every character matters and every island visited adds to a grander narrative about dreams and freedom. For readers willing to invest the time, One Piece offers an adventure unparalleled in modern fiction.

Fantasy / Isekai (Another World)

Anime: Frieren: Beyond Journey’s End
Why watch: A contemplative fantasy about an elf mage outliving her hero party. She embarks on a new journey to understand human emotions and mortality. Gorgeous animation, quiet character moments, and a refreshing take on “post-adventure” life.
Best for: Viewers who prefer emotional depth over constant battles.

Manga: Witch Hat Atelier
Why read: Stunningly detailed art and a unique magic system based on drawing runes. A young girl discovers that magic is not just for the gifted — but it comes with dangerous rules. Whimsical yet serious, with a focus on craftsmanship and ethics.
Best for: Fans of Fullmetal Alchemist or The Ancient Magus’ Bride.
